Future链式使用
作者:
凯司机 | 来源:发表于
2021-08-20 15:54 被阅读0次import 'dart:io';
main(List<String> args) {
print('start');
Future((){
sleep(Duration(seconds: 3));
return "第1次的结果";
}).then((res){
print(res);
sleep(Duration(seconds: 3));
return "第2次的结果";
}).then((res){
print(res);
sleep(Duration(seconds: 3));
return "第3次的结果";
}).then((res){
print(res);
sleep(Duration(seconds: 3));
return "第4次的结果";
}).then((res){
print(res);
}).catchError((error) {
print("$error");
}).whenComplete((){
print("全部执行结束...");
});
print("end");
}
本文标题:Future链式使用
本文链接:https://www.haomeiwen.com/subject/csekultx.html
网友评论